Job Overview
As a Cover Supervisor, you will be responsible for overseeing the smooth running of lessons in the absence of the regular teacher. You will supervise students, ensuring they engage with pre-prepared work, maintain good behaviour, and continue their learning in a positive environment. This is an exciting opportunity to support students and work in a dynamic educational environment.
Key Responsibilities
- Supervise classes in the absence of the class teacher, ensuring students remain on task and focused.
- Deliver pre-planned lessons, ensuring students follow instructions and complete their work.
- Manage student behaviour in line with school policies, maintaining a positive and productive learning environment.
- Provide support to students with additional needs as required, including helping them to stay engaged with their learning.
- Ensure the classroom is well-organised and tidy, promoting a safe and structured environment.
- Communicate effectively with students and staff, as necessary to address any concerns or issues.
- Report back to the school staff or department on any incidents or challenges faced during the lesson.
- Take part in any training or development programs as required.

How to prepare for a job interview at TeachMatch Educational Recruitment Agency
β¨Know Your Role
Make sure you understand the responsibilities of a Cover Supervisor. Familiarise yourself with how to manage student behaviour and deliver pre-planned lessons. This will help you answer questions confidently and show that you're ready for the role.
β¨Show Your Passion for Education
During the interview, express your enthusiasm for working with students and supporting their learning. Share any relevant experiences you've had in educational settings, even if theyβre informal, to demonstrate your commitment to making a positive impact.
β¨Prepare for Behaviour Management Questions
Expect questions about how you would handle challenging behaviour in the classroom. Think of specific examples from your past experiences where you successfully managed a difficult situation, as this will showcase your problem-solving skills.
β¨Ask Insightful Questions
At the end of the interview, donβt forget to ask questions! Inquire about the schoolβs approach to supporting students with additional needs or what professional development opportunities are available. This shows your interest in the role and your desire to grow within the position.
